The Woodward 5415-856 is a digital microprocessor‑based controller and electro‑hydraulic (I/H) converter module for 505 / 505E / 505XT turbine governor systems. It integrates closed‑loop speed/load control, valve positioning, and hydraulic drive electronics into a single rack‑mount unit, serving as the primary interface between the governor and steam/gas turbine actuators.

2. General Description

The 5415-856 combines a high‑precision analog output stage, dual solenoid drivers, MPU speed input, and field‑programmable control logic. It accepts 4–20 mA / 1–5 Vdc commands from the 505‑series governor, processes speed/position feedback, and drives hydraulic proportional or on‑off valves to regulate turbine speed, load, and overspeed protection. Designed for redundant, hot‑swap operation, it ensures high reliability in power generation, oil & gas, and industrial turbine applications.

3. Key Features

  • Integrated Controller & I/H Converter: Combines governor logic and hydraulic drive in one module

  • Dual Solenoid Outputs: For main throttle and governor valve control

  • MPU Speed Input: Magnetic pickup input for direct turbine speed sensing

  • 16‑bit Analog I/O: High‑resolution command/feedback signals (4–20 mA / 1–5 Vdc)

  • Closed‑Loop Control: Built‑in PID for valve position and speed regulation

  • 2500 V Galvanic Isolation: Protects against EMI/RFI and ground loops

  • Extended Temperature: −40 °C to +85 °C operating range

  • Hot‑Swap & Redundancy: Online replacement and redundant system support

  • Comprehensive Diagnostics: LED status + non‑volatile fault logging

  • Short‑Circuit/Overload Protection: On all I/O and drive channels

4. Technical Specifications

  • Model: 5415-856

  • Manufacturer: Woodward (USA)

  • Compatible Governors: 505, 505E, 505XT

  • Speed Input: 1 × MPU (magnetic pickup), 0–10 kHz

  • Analog Inputs: 2 ch (4–20 mA / 1–5 Vdc), 16‑bit

  • Analog Outputs: 2 ch (4–20 mA), 16‑bit

  • Digital Outputs: 2 × solenoid drivers (24 Vdc, 2 A max)

  • Communication: Modbus TCP/IP, PROFIBUS DP (diagnostics)

  • Power Supply: 24 Vdc ±10% (18–32 Vdc), 40 W max

  • Operating Temperature: −40 °C to +85 °C

  • Storage Temperature: −40 °C to +85 °C

  • Dimensions (W×H×D): 180 × 120 × 50 mm

  • Weight: Approx. 1.2 kg

  • Mounting: 19” rack or panel mount

  • Certifications: CE, RoHS, MIL‑STD‑810G
